About This Property
(831) 334-7676 - Unique Opportunity in Westside Santa Cruz - Just completed, independent, 1-bedroom, 1 bath second floor apartment, with an additional art studio or remote office — just minutes from the UC Santa Cruz campus. This new unit is in a secluded location and features a private entrance, an enclosed entry garden with mature loquat tree, and an exterior deck (off the main living area) situated under a towering redwood tree — perfect for coffee in the morning. The apartment is in a new Craftsman-style building with custom windows, steelwork, and woodwork throughout. Dimensions are 587 square feet, plus a 48 square foot deck, and a 152 square foot fenced garden entryway. Apartment Amenities: Marmoleum flooring, new stainless steel appliances, walk-in closet, washer/dryer, radiant heat, water filtration system, and cable connections for Internet. The art studio or office is 253 square feet and features an early 20th century stained glass window, skylight, utility sink, cable connections for Internet, and outdoor work area. (RLNE4589216)

Westside Santa Cruz is a thriving commercial district home to some of the best shops, restaurants, and business right outside of the Bay Area. The southern tip of the neighborhood sits closest to the shore and consists of a wide range of apartment styles. Head to Swift Street to find trendy restaurants, shops, and breweries in and around the Swift Street Courtyard, or travel along Mission Street for more great shopping and dining opportunities. Front Street, located right outside of the neighborhood west of Swift Street, has countless stores and eateries like the Cooperhouse Shopping Center and San Lorenzo Park Plaza Shopping Center.
Shopping and dining aren’t the only attractions of Westside. Part of the neighborhood is located on the coast, so beaches and greenspaces are abundant. Check out Natural Bridges State Park, Henry Cowell Redwoods State Park, and Wilder Ranch State Park for a plethora of outdoor adventures.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
